20 August 2025

Tallies three hits

Saggese went 3-for-4 with a steal, an RBI and two runs scored in Tuesday's win over the Marlins.

Analysis

Saggese notched a base hit in each of his first three at-bats, though the exit velocity did not top 80 mph on any of his knocks. He's been making good contact in August with a .300 batting average in 15 games and figures to see extended playing time in the short term with Brendan Donovan (groin) on the injured list while Nolan Gorman mans third base in the absence of Nolan Arenado (shoulder).

18 August 2025

Picking up ninth straight start

Saggese will start at second base and bat seventh in Monday's game against the Marlins.

Analysis

With Brendan Donovan (groin) landing on the injured list after sitting out each of the Cardinals' previous three contests, Saggese looks to have some short-term security in St. Louis' everyday lineup. Saggese will draw a ninth straight start Monday, after he went 9-for-30 (.300 average) with two RBI, three runs and one stolen base over the previous eight contests. However, Saggese has posted a .409 BABIP and a 0:8 BB:K during that eight-game stretch, so his overall production could look less appealing once his good fortune on balls in play inevitably takes a turn for the worse.

15 August 2025

Bumped into starting nine

Saggese will bat seventh and play second base Friday against the Yankees, John Denton of MLB.com reports.

Analysis

Saggese was thrust into the starting nine late Friday afternoon after Brendan Donovan was scratched with a foot injury. Saggese will look to extend his six-game hit streak.
